      # $Id: Portfile 30258 2007-10-23 02:30:22Z jmpp macports.org $

      PortSystem 1.0

      Name: xffm
      Version: 4.2.4
      Category: xfce
      Platform: darwin
      Maintainers: nomaintainer
      Description: Xffm is the integration of xftree, xfsamba and xfglob with additional enhancements and use of the gtk-2.0 library.
      Long Description: ${description}
      Homepage: http://www.xfce.org/
      master_sites http://www.us.xfce.org/archive/xfce-${version}/src
      checksums md5 8b2097c239104e60542c42243aa8b319 sha1 f2eaa1e0aeb23bbf9cff7636c7ad93ff3db2aaae rmd160 a2418f0dc11b231e5a0e7ad613cd377ae7016024
      configure.args --disable-debug --enable-final --enable-menu --enable-panel
      patchfiles uri.h-patch
      depends_lib port:xfce-mcs-manager

      Variant: samba {
      depends_bin-append port:samba3
      configure.args-append --enable-smbbranch
      }

    If you haven't already installed Darwin Ports, you can find easy instructions for doing so at the main Darwin Ports page.

    Once Darwin Ports has been installed, in a terminal window and while online, type the following and hit return:


      %  cd /opt/local/bin/portslocation/dports/xffm
      % sudo port install xffm
      Password:
    You will then be prompted for your root password, which you should enter. You may have to wait for a few minutes while the software is retrieved from the network and installed for you. Y ou should see something that looks similar to:

      ---> Fetching xffm
      ---> Verifying checksum for xffm
      ---> Extracting xffm
      ---> Configuring xffm
      ---> Building xffm with target all
      ---> Staging xffm into destroot
      ---> Installing xffm
    - Make sure that you do not close the terminal window while Darwin Ports is working. Once the software has been installed, you can find further information about using xffm with these commands:
      %  man xffm
      % apropos xffm
      % which xffm
      % locate xffm
